Transaction 761c3ff21d764d6a82f8e45b69e3703acccfad6e7c6645787949abf4e5584db6
1 Input
2 Outputs
- 761c3ff21d764d6a82f8e45b69e3703acccfad6e7c6645787949abf4e5584db6:0
- 761c3ff21d764d6a82f8e45b69e3703acccfad6e7c6645787949abf4e5584db6:1
value 5434079
address 16AneqpymATKKKRxGoVVX5SYAXGGeszVef
value 21704080
address 1HqydzkfkeZMHtAwrBMEGg4TyCZscy89ck